[17:15] <~Anshu> The murmurs die down at Ziyad's polite rebuke, and he nods to the Empress, who turns to look around at the assembled Celestials.
 
 
[17:16] <~Anshu> "Greetings, Deliberators. I know many of you consider me a hated enemy. I cannot blame you for that, for I have given you ample justification. But today I would address you not as an enemy, but as a potentially useful tool, if nothing else."
 
 
[17:20] <~Anshu> "I expect that I am to be executed, perhaps after a trial, perhaps not. This too I cannot blame you for. If our positions were reveresed, I would and have done exactly the same."
 
 
[17:21] <~Anshu> "Not only have I led forces in rebellion against you, but in exile I would continue to be a symbol to those forces, and the power I possess over those who bear my bloodline is a critical and fundamental weakness in your military. You cannot allow me to live for any great length of time."
 
 
[17:24] * Nomoe_Hideaki nods with appreciation. Her frank speech, unafraid of pointing out the logic of her own death, is worth a measure of respect. Of course it remains to be seen where she is going with this.
 
 
[17:26] * Bright_Snow eyes scan the audience, watching the crowd even as the Empress speaks gauging their reaction
 
 
[17:32] <Brazen_Sand> Brazen sits back and listens, feeling pity for the woman...but also remembering the ruthlessness of the Realm
 
 
[17:32] * Shrike keeps her eyes on the Empress, ready for her to try something.
 
 
[17:36] <~Anshu> "With that said, I believe that I can still be of use to Creation, and to you, in the time I have left. I would ask that I be permitted, under guard of course, to address Creation using the communication systems of the Sword of Creation, to announce my abdication and confirm you as my legitimate successors."
 
 
[17:37] <~Anshu> "And I ask that whether you sentence me today or after a public trial, allow me to die in service to Creation, not just as a condemned prisoner. Point me at some great threat you wish defeated, so that in death I can return to my first and greatest ambition - to protect Creation, no matter the cost."
 
 
[17:40] <Brazen_Sand> Brazen stood up. "I believe her."
 
 
[17:43] <~Anshu> In many of the spectators there is a grudging respect for the Empress. There is some cynicism, some whose enmity is too strong to feel anything else.
 
 
[17:46] * Shrike nods slightly, remaining quiet but willing to accept the Empress's story., ~Trust, but verify.~
 
 
[17:48] * Nomoe_Hideaki sits quietly, sympathetic to her request, but whether to grant it ... he is undecided yet.
 
 
[17:52] * Bright_Snow looks distainful and unconvinced.
 
 
[17:57] <~Anshu> Discussion breaks out again, SNow's arrival almost forgotten as the Deliberative digests the Empress's words.
 
 
[18:05] <~Anshu> After a short while, Anshu speaks. "I see no reason why the second request, at least, should not be granted. Though sentencing is usually an internal matter for the Ministry of Justice, under the circumstances I shall invite opinions from the rest of the Deliberative. Are there any objections to Kaida Vanida's second request?"
 
 
[18:06] <Shrike> "I have no objections to it, providing she is well-supervised"
 
 
[18:08] <Nomoe_Hideaki> "There are practical concerns to be addressed regarding the necessary Deliberative oversight and verification, but beyond that ... only that we should consider carefully the precedent we set here, or make very clear that none is being set."
 
 
[18:11] <Bright_Snow> "And why should we allow her an honourable death? She is a traitor to creation, by her own admission."
 
 
[18:13] <Shrike> "The fact that she is willing to admit it speaks volumes - at least to me."
 
 
[18:14] <Brazen_Sand> "Because if she speaks up, she'll at least get those Purists off our backs.
 
 
[18:15] <Brazen_Sand> Brazen pointed out.
 
 
[18:16] <Bright_Snow> "Not really, they will likely speak of Mind Control and mutter something about Anathema." Snow shrugs, "Those that fight us now, they either have lost too much in the change of the status quo or are zealots who will fight regardless of reality."
 
 
[18:17] <~Anshu> "We allow Abyssals to work with the Deliberative toward redemption. A few are even seated here today. Why should we not allow her to seek an honorable death as expiation for her crimes?"
 
 
[18:17] <Brazen_Sand> "But if the Scarlet Empress is supposed to be more powerful then Anathema, then how can she be controlled by us?"
 
 
[18:18] <Nomoe_Hideaki> "Let us not discuss the logic of misguided fanatics, it is pointless," Nomoe points out.
 
 
[18:19] <Bright_Snow> "Bec..." Snow pauses for a second considering various arguments, "A point well made." She sits back down, not noticing she had risen to speak as she once favoured doing.
 
 
[18:19] <Bright_Snow> Surrendering the floor, and withdrawing her argument
 
 
[18:20] <Brazen_Sand> "But the point, Deliberator Nomoe, is that if even a few of the more moderate members of the Purists are swayed, then the momentum within the movement will change."
 
 
[18:23] * Nomoe_Hideaki doesn't rise to answer, making a sweeping gesture instead to indicate he considers the discussion of little relevance to the matter at hand.
 
 
[18:31] <~Anshu> None can think of a substantive objection to the Empress's second request, but the first is met with adamant refusal to let the Empress ever set foot in the Sword of Creation again.
 
 
[18:36] <Brazen_Sand> Brazen just sat back down. He could only give his vote on it.
 
 
[18:36] <~Anshu> DSV speaks up with a possible compromise: "Perhaps she could be allowed to record a message, to be played later."
 
 
[18:37] <Brazen_Sand> Brazen nodded. That seemed reasonable.
 
 
[18:37] <Shrike> "That...could be acceptable.'
 
 
[18:38] <Brazen_Sand> "I believe that is a good compromise." Brazen stated.
 
 
[18:38] <Brazen_Sand> Putting his support behind the idea as his anima illustrated calming pictures of compromise and unity
 
 
[18:39] * Nomoe_Hideaki supports the position that the Empress be allowed to address the people, so long as her speech is carefully supervised to make sure it contains no information that 'is not required for the common man to know'
 
 
[18:39] <Nomoe_Hideaki> And of course she not step into the Sword of Creation itself.
 
 
[18:43] <~Anshu> After some more wheeling and dealing, a vote is called. The results are marginally in favor of allowing the Empress a heroic death, and to record a supervised message.
